Chicken Packets
BY JANEEN TKACYZK

Mix together:
2 c. cooked, shredded chicken
1 box of softened cream cheese
1 T. Chopped chives (I usually add 2-3 T)
2 T milk
Salt, to taste

In one bowl, add 1 sleeve of plain Bakin’ Miracle coating mix

In another bowl, melt  ¼ c. butter

Unroll 2 pkgs of crescent rolls.  Roll two triangles together to form a rectangle.  Take chicken mixture above and place inside crescent rectangle.  Seal together.  Dip in melted butter and then in Bakin’ Miracle.

Place on a cookie tray.  Bake for 20 minutes at 350 degrees.  I usually double this recipe as my family really loves them!  I do make some with just melted butter and no Bakin’ Miracle.  You can also use the Parmesan Bakin’ Miracle or Shake n’ Bake coatings, too.
